SafetyCall International (SCI) is looking for an experienced Accounting Coordinator to join our team! This individual is responsible supporting SafetyCall’s accounting efforts, accurately and ethically, in the following functional areas: accounts receivable, accounts payable, payroll and others as assigned.
The Accounting Coordinator is a full-time, Monday-Friday, position. This position will report to our Bloomington, MN office, but will have flexibility to work from home 3-4 days a week as well.
Responsibilities:
- Create and distribute invoicing via email or by utilizing various client specific portals and purchasing systems.
- Provide support and promptly resolve billing inquiries and collection issues with clients.
- Input assigned new clients into QuickBooks.
- Assist with the reconciliation of credit card payments and QuickBooks records against entries in the proprietary software.
- Assist with the processing and recording of accounts payable transactions, ensuring vendor invoices are accurate and that all invoices and staff reimbursements are paid accurately and in accordance with policies and procedures.
- Assist with vendor expense analysis and tracking.
- Assist with filing and archiving of accounting documents.
- Assist with billing data for long distance telephone calls.
- Provide support for biweekly payroll process by working with the Human Resource Manager to learn the process and complete payroll as needed.
- Assist with multi-state payroll tax set up and maintenance, including completing and submitting initial registration with state and local agencies and working with payroll provider to establish new state setup within the software. Monitor quarterly tax reports and resolve issues as they arise.
- Assist with reviewing Payroll reports and preparing journal entries for input into QuickBooks.
- Assist various payment programs by communicating with clinics, processing credit cards, and working with IT vendor (s) to update clinic lists in databases.
- Assist with processing consumer credit card information accurately and according to policies and procedures.
- Assist with the process of producing and distributing receipts to clinics and/or pet owners as requested.
- Assist with entering and tracking consultant time into QuickBooks.

About Us
SCI is a 24/7 multidisciplinary health care practice, licensed by the boards of Medicine, Pharmacy, and Veterinary Medicine, that provides manufacturers with adverse event management, regulatory reporting, post-market surveillance, customer service and consulting services. Pet Poison Helpline (PPH) is a 24-hour animal poison control service for pet owners and veterinary professionals who require assistance with treating a potentially poisoned pet.
